Reform UK conference highlights: Eminem, conspiracy theories and a plan to modernise
Nigel Farage has predicted he can win the next general election at a packed Reform UK conference that announced a new structure for the party and leaned heavily into hard-right tropes and occasional conspiracy theories.

At the gathering – which included repeated attacks on immigration, diversity and green policies, and calls to ‘put British people first’ – Farage promised to professionalise the party and end its status as a company majority-owned by him. Instead, he said, it would become a mass-owned non-profit organisation with significant control by members – although he did not say what this would entail
